1. Understanding Genetic Engineering for Immortality:
Genetic engineering for immortality involves manipulating genes and genetic material to slow down the aging process and extend the human lifespan. Scientists are actively studying various approaches to achieve this, including repairing damaged DNA, enhancing cellular regeneration, and delaying the onset of age-related diseases.
2. Exploring the Ethical and Moral Considerations:
As with any revolutionary scientific development, genetic engineering for immortality raises important ethical and moral considerations. Issues surrounding access and distribution of life-extending technologies, concerns about societal implications, and the impact on the environment are just a few of the topics that scientists, bioethicists, and policymakers are grappling with.
